  • Okay now that we've seen how broken this card is after the nerfs, I'd like to point out how lazy the design of this quest is. You literally don't have to do anything to complete it, you don't need to build your deck in a special way and the reward is the only quest reward for which you don't have to spend any mana, your cards just become OP. Sure, you can run out of steam and the deck can be defeated, but that was not my point. It's just very unfun to play against. Just imagine if the shaman quest reward hero power was a passive.
